#8645B5 Color
#8645B5 is rgb(134, 69, 181) in RGB, hsl(275, 45%, 49%) in HSL, and about cmyk(26%, 62%, 0%, 29%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Purple Heart (#69359C),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.64.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#8645B5 Channel Values
How #8645B5 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 134 · G 69 · B 181 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 275° · S 45% · L 49%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 275° · S 62% · V 71%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 26% · M 62% · Y 0% · K 29%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.95:1 vs white · 3.53: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#8645B5 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#8645B5 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#8645B5?
#8645B5 is a mid-tone purple — rgb(134, 69, 181) in RGB and hsl(275, 45%, 49%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Purple Heart (#69359C),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.64.
What is the RGB value of #8645B5?
#8645B5 is rgb(134, 69, 181) — red 134, green 69, and blue 181 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#8645B5?
#8645B5 converts to approximately cmyk(26%, 62%, 0%, 29%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#8645B5 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#8645B5 scores 5.95:1 against white and 3.53: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#8645B5 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#8645B5 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is rebeccapurple (#663399) at a CIE76 distance of 10.69, which is visibly different.
